Atalanta midfielder Ederson is reportedly open to joining Inter Milan during the current summer transfer window.
This according to today’s print edition of Milan-based newspaper Gazzetta dello Sport, via FCInterNews.
Inter Milan are bracing for the possibility of a departure for Hakan Calhanoglu.
If the Turkish international is to leave, then the Nerazzurri will certainly have a big gap to fill in their midfield.
Therefore, Inter are already laying out their list of targets in central areas.
There looks to be one name at the top of Inter’s list. Atalanta midfielder Ederson would be the Nerazzurri’s priority option to replace Calhanoglu.
According to the Gazzetta dello Sport, Ederson himself would be happy to join Inter.
The Brazilian would not be against the idea of staying in Serie A. It is already a league that he knows very well.
Furthermore, the Gazzetta suggest, continuing to play in the Italian top flight would provide Ederson with a showcase for new Brazil coach Carlo Ancelotti.
As such, if Inter can make a convincing offer to Atalanta, then Ederson certainly won’t turn down the move.
